Output 8abb5a22f30c7fe1095ea2b67cd7b5656ae9a8c8899caaeeee13eea851d2dd61:17

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ed1953fe981a863cd3d6bbd0c52eda719302c6c OP_EQUAL
address
3BnyKjAAmsEhjb7uqtf58pw1391cLjcvea
transaction
8abb5a22f30c7fe1095ea2b67cd7b5656ae9a8c8899caaeeee13eea851d2dd61